There are many powerful tools available to help individuals, couples, and families achieve meaningful, positive change in their lives. As a psychologist in clinical practice for over 25 years, I am vitally engaged in the process of integrating a broad range of therapeutic practices to meet the unique needs of each client. Effective psychotherapy can be of great assistance in negotiating the complexities of modern human existence. Engaging mind, heart, and intuition, it is a process that may become an "adventure of the Soul" imparting profound benefit beyond the alleviation of symptoms.
A strong client-therapist relationship is critical to successful psychotherapy. Most clients experience my presence as warm, calm, collaborative, and genuine. Careful, attuned listening is at the heart of my approach, but I am not hesitant to offer observations, suggestions, "road maps" for healing, (and humor).
In addition to private practice, I served as Director of Psychological Counseling Services at Bowdoin College from 1990-2004, have provided clinical supervision for many other therapists, and have lectured and consulted throughout the Northeast. I am married and a parent of two young adult children.
